Body

Origins and Family

Stanley Drucker was born in Brooklyn[2]. He was born on February 4, 1929[3].

Education

Educated at High School of Music & Art[11], an art academy[32], in United States[33], founded in 1936[34] and Curtis Institute of Music[12], a conservatory[35], in United States[36], founded in 1924[37]. Stanley Drucker studied under Leon Russianoff[17].

Career and Affiliations

Stanley Drucker worked as a clarinetist[6]. His field of work was clarinet performance[9]. Among his employers was New York Philharmonic[10].

Death and Burial

Stanley Drucker died on December 19, 2022[5]. He passed away in Vista[4].
